‘Exceptional’ manager named regional Pride in the Job champion

Exceptional site manager Dennis Howard has staked a claim to become one of the best house-builders in the UK after being named as a regional champion in the 34th annual Pride in the Job Awards.

Selected from around 15,000 site managers across the country, Dennis of CALA Homes Ltd was named Southern champion, winning the Medium Builder Category for his work on the Dixons Wharf site in Wilstone, Tring.

He is now shortlisted for the competition’s Supreme Gala Final in January, where the national champions will be announced.

The Pride in the Job Awards are run by NHBC, the UK’s leading new-home warranty provider.

Nick Cunningham, NHBC regional director, congratulated Dennis on his win: “Dennis is building some of the very best houses in the UK, demonstrating consistently high standards, and is in the top half a percent of his profession.”

Dennis said he enjoys the challenges and sense of achievement in his job.

He said: “I am immensely proud of this award.

“I’ve chased this award for many years, and although have been on winning teams, this is the first I have won on my own merits.”
